Transaction 8828c72e79b10b3c40f5daaccc73a690f453dde42c342fe964a5e90b569cc167
1 Input
1 Output
-
8828c72e79b10b3c40f5daaccc73a690f453dde42c342fe964a5e90b569cc167:0
- value
- 17104413
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 150028f26b8800b1b81b0055ecbe0a5628fa6c18 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12v3P9EKy2mgVDha7y1TNTdyPuBS8EP73W